So happy to bring our Ubuntu Legacy members and youth together again, learning side by side through food, culture, and true storytelling.

Today’s plant-based meal prep reminded me that herbs, spices, and vegetables are more than ingredients, they carry history, tradition, and wisdom. Our chef didn’t just show us how to combine flavours, she taught us the richness behind them and helped everyone understand the “why” as we cooked together.

Moments like this are exactly what Ubuntu is about: connection, learning across generations, and building community in a way that feels warm, meaningful, and rooted.

Last evening was absolutely beautiful.

I watched our members open their hearts and their space to welcome Reveille Afriq, a local business owner facing real challenges keeping her store doors open. What unfolded was pure Ubuntu in action—our community didn’t just show up, they showed *up* with warmth, thoughtfulness, and genuine care.

Our social committee came together once again to create something truly special. They embodied what we stand for: being loving, supportive, and welcoming to those around us. It was a blast, and honestly, the energy in that room reminded me exactly why this work matters.

We couldn’t have made this happen without our incredible partners. A heartfelt thank you to GTA Phoenix Lions Club and Amica Erin Mills for the generous door prizes, and to the City of Mississauga for believing in our mission to combat isolation, loneliness, and improve the wellbeing of our older adults.

Ubuntu Legacy Community Care is feeling deeply grateful today. After our yoga class this morning, one of our member organizations, GTA Phoenix Lions Club, presented us with a $300 cheque to sponsor our Ubuntu Game Night. Moments like this remind us that community care is not just what we do, it is what we build together.

This sponsorship helps us create a welcoming, culturally grounded space where seniors can laugh, connect, and reduce isolation through simple joy and togetherness. To the GTA Phoenix Lions Club: thank you for standing with our elders and investing in meaningful community connection.
